How much do sales porter j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for sales porter in the United States is $15.02,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.18 and $16.11 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are Sales Porters?

Sales Porters are employees who support the sales team in automotive dealerships or similar retail environments by maintaining the cleanliness and organization of vehicles and the showroom. Their responsibilities often include moving vehicles, performing light maintenance, assisting with vehicle deliveries, and ensuring the lot is presentable for customers. Sales Porters play a vital role in creating a positive first impression for customers and helping sales operations run smoothly.

Is being a porter a hard job?

A sales porter job involves physical tasks such as lifting, moving, and organizing goods, which can be physically demanding. The job often requires good stamina, attention to safety procedures,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ment, making it moderately challenging for some individuals.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Sales Porter at a dealership?

As a Sales Porter, your daily responsibilities often include moving and organizing vehicles on the lot, ensuring cars are clean and presentable for customers, assisting with vehicle deliveries, and supporting the sales team with various tasks. You may also be responsible for basic maintenance checks and helping with lot organization to create a welcoming environment for customers. This role is fast-paced and requires strong attention to detail, teamwork, and communication with sales, service, and management staff to keep operations running smoothly.
